About The Role
We arecurrently recruiting for a Facilities Team Leader to join our headoffice site in Barton-upon-Humber. The shift will be from Monday toFriday, 14:30 – 23:00
Salary: £32,500 + Quarterly Bonus up to £250
About the role:

  • Supporting team members ensuring all duties are completed on a daily basis
  • Conducting team meetings to update members on best practices and continuing expectations
  • Ensuring your team wear the uniform issued by Wren Kitchens at all time whilst on site
  • Undertaking any facilities cleaning and warehouse duties as requested by your management team
  • Developing strategies to promote team member adherence to company regulations and performance goals
  • Answering team member questions, help with team member problems, and oversee team members work for quality and guideline compliance
    In addition to any other duties, as a responsible person you must ensure that you have read, understood, and adhere to polices and procedure relating to Health and Safety and your responsibilities located in the Integrated Management System (IMS) Responsibilities document.

About You
Desired skills & knowledge:

  • Ability to give directions to team members
  • Possess strong interpersonal skills to relate with all members of the team
  • Organisational skills, flexibility and punctuality
  • Previous experience in cleaning and waste management preferred, but not essential
